Nathan Aspinall has fired back at Dave Chisnall and Mike De Decker after refusing to take criticism of his Premier League selection lying down. The Asp was one of the four wildcard picks for the annual darting roadshow, which begins in Belfast on February 6. The selection of Aspinall and Gerwyn Price has triggered plenty of debate among darts fans and hasn’t gone down well with players who missed out.

World Grand Prix champion De Decker called his omission “scandalous”, telling Belgian media that Aspinall has only been selected for “entertainment” reasons due to his popular walk-on song, Mr Brightside by The Killers. Chisnall, the highest-ranked player not to be in the Premier League, aimed a similar jibe at Aspinall. Writing in his blog, he said: “Gezzy [Price] has had a lot going and struggled in 2024, whilst Nathan has done similarly. His run to the quarter-finals of the Worlds probably got him involved. That and everyone loving his Mr Brightside theme song.

“It’s a great entrance, but it should be about the darts, and not your walk-on that gets you involved in these big competitions. Nothing against them personally, as both great lads and get on well with, but it should be about your actions on the dartboard, not on a song and a dance.”.

Aspinall was stung by Chisnall’s comments in particular. Speaking to Mirror Sport ahead of the Bahrain Masters, he said: “He [De Decker] can say what he wants. He’s not helping himself, in my opinion. “I’m very disappointed in Dave, who I class as one of my close mates on the tour. That post was directly aimed at me.
